Android app icon resize12/22/2023 ![]() Have been optimized for beautiful display on all common platforms and display Each icon is created using our design guidelines to depict in simpleĪnd minimal forms the universal concepts used commonly throughout a UI.Įnsuring readability and clarity at both large and small sizes, these icons Material design system icons are simple, modern, friendly, and sometimes The debug package is used to support low-level debugging.An overview of material icons-where to get them and how to integrate them with your projects. ![]() In general, these should not need to be modified. circleci/images/makefile makefile to build them, but permissions to push to the dwmkerr Docker Hub account are required to publish these images. The builds use custom docker images which contain the appropriate Node.js runtime, as well as the ImageMagick binaries. You can run the CircleCI build locally with the following command: make circleci Note that semantic-version is used, meaning a changelog is automatically kept up to date, and versioning is handled semantically based on the commit message. Push and deploy git push -tags & git push & npm publish.This allows the CHANGELOG to be kept up to date automatically, and ensures that semantic versioning can be expected from the library. Commit MessagesĬonventional Commits should be used. So please be careful if changing the quotes and test on both platforms. Leaving the pattern unquoted works for cmd as well as the shell in builds for now. However for some reason on AppVeyor this doesn't seem to work. Note that best practices are to pass Mocha a quoted string with a glob pattern for cross-platform execution of tests (see Mocha Docs). Tests are executed with Mocha and coverage is handled by Istanbul. Install the dependencies (I recommend Node Version Manager): artifacts/coverage.Ĭurrently the linting style is based on airbnb. Runs the tests, writing coverage reports to. Useful commands for development are: Command The only dependencies are Node 8 (or above) and Yarn. The reason we generate both is to ensure that after generate is run, all icons in the project will be consistent. ![]() This technically makes the density specific icons redundant. This is a large size icon which Android from v26 onwards will automatically rescale as needed to all other sizes. However, we also generate the res/mipmap-anydpi-v26/ adaptive icon. Note that Adaptive Icons of all supported sizes are generated. To test how adaptive icons will look when animated, swiped, etc, the Adaptive Icons website by Marius Claret is very useful! There is an excellent guide on developing Adaptive Icons here. If the feature is working well for users then I will document in detail its usage, until then it is an 'experimental' feature! The init command will be the first to bring support, then generate. None of the current commands support the -adaptive-icons flag. Creating or generating adaptive icons is done via the -adaptive-icons flag.Adaptive Icons are 'opt in' for now, they won't be generated by default.This will happen in stages and should be considered an 'alpha' feature until otherwise noted. Support for Adaptive Icons for Android is being introduced. To label adaptive icons, simply run the label command against the foregroud adaptive icon image. This is a useful trick when you are creating things like internal QA versions of your app, where you might want to show a version number or other label in the icon itself. This would produce output like the below image:
0 Comments
Leave a Reply.A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|